CSS Articles, Videos, Tips, & More

Discover in-depth articles, video tutorials, and quick tips to help you master CSS and stay on top of the latest web design trends and techniques.

Issue #374

Issue #374

Newsletter
Zoran Jambor

Learn why you shouldn't be wary of reading CSS specifications, how to monitor the quality and complexity of CSS, how to animate variable fonts, and more.

View issue
Issue #370

Issue #370

Newsletter
Zoran Jambor

Learn how to create accessible fluid web typography, how to detect unexpected layout shifts, how to implement an accessible navigation menu, how to use variable fonts, and more.

View issue
Issue #368

Issue #368

Newsletter
Zoran Jambor

Learn why you should break up your frontend into smaller pieces, why you need a certain mindset to write good CSS, how to create grid-based layouts, and more.

View issue
Issue #367

Issue #367

Newsletter
Zoran Jambor

Learn what it takes to convert the compressed data to an image, how to define a robust CSS architecture, how to improve render times using critical CSS, and more.

View issue
Issue #366

Issue #366

Newsletter
Zoran Jambor

Learn how to position and sort items using Grid Shepherd technique, how to create a parallax effect using Rellax, how to enforce a performance budget with Lighthouse, and more.

View issue
Issue #359

Issue #359

Newsletter
Zoran Jambor

Learn how to convert a standard checkbox into a visual toggle using progressive enhancement, how to measure and diagnose performance bottlenecks in your animations, how to set up Percy along with CircleCI to test visual regressions, and more.

View issue
Issue #358

Issue #358

Newsletter
Zoran Jambor

Learn how the process of CSS standardization works, how to natively lazy-load images, how to use the upcoming CSS env() feature, and more.

View issue
Issue #356

Issue #356

Newsletter
Zoran Jambor

Learn everything you need to know about hyphenation in CSS, how to create blurred borders in CSS, how to encapsulate style and structure with Shadow DOM, and more.

View issue
Issue #355

Issue #355

Newsletter
Zoran Jambor

Learn how to convince a skeptical team to adopt CSS Grid, how to create compelling grid patterns, how to debug CSS, why you should structure CSS around appearance and layout, and more.

View issue
Issue #354

Issue #354

Newsletter
Zoran Jambor

Learn what CSS algorithms are and how to write one, what is the current state of CSS, how will the aspect ratio unit for CSS work, how to manipulate colors using JavaScript, and more.

View issue
Baseline Status for Video

Baseline Status for Video

A handy online tool that will let you easily show Baseline Status in your videos.

Try It Now »
AI Developer Newsletter

AI Developer Newsletter

A short, friendly roundup of the most useful tools, ideas, and real-world examples—curated specifically for developers like you.

Subscribe Today »
CSS Stickers

CSS Stickers

A set of beautiful, cute, and funny CSS stickers to showcase your love for CSS.

Get Your Set Today »